View Formula Properties
- Open the formula whose properties you want to view.
-
Click Open/Close Dock
in the vertical bar to the right of the formula grid.
The Formula Properties pane opens.
The Formula Properties pane has the following tabs:
Weights. These properties define how batches of the formula are created (by weight, volume, or piece size), and how they are measured. For more information, see Formula Properties: Weights.
References. These properties define general summary information about the formula (name, creator, date of creation, purpose, and so on). For more information, see Formula Properties: References.
Genealogy. These properties describe the history of the formula through cloning of earlier formulas. For more information, see Formula Properties: Genealogy.
Experiments. These properties list the Scientific Notebook experiments that include the formula. For more information, see Formula Properties: Experiments.
Note: If you select a row in the table, properties are visible for the row, and not for the formula. To switch to properties for the formula, cancel the row selection.
